Product Description

From the Author

Full color priceguide/discography-ALL Disney related records
This book, a price-guide/discography, covers all Disney and Disney-related shellac/vinyl records produced from 1933-1988 when Disney switched over to the CD format. It includes over 200 full color pictures of the glorious Disney art covers for some of these records, as well as a history of Disney recorded music; a composer filmography for over 750 features and shorts; and information on grading, buying and selling these historical recordings. It covers over 3300 recordings, with artist and song information as well as current prices. A must have for the Disneyana fan and record collector as well. Animation artwork collectors or enthusiasts will appreciate seeing Disney artwork released only for the records market. The first and only book of its kind. Collectibles that can talk back to you! 5.0 out of 5 stars An Outstanding Reference for the Disney Vinyl Collector, 14 Jan 1998
By A Customer
"The Golden Age of Walt Disney Records" is a must have reference book for anyone who collects Disney vinyl. I myself had started a free on-line reference list, and can vouch that this book is extremely complete in its coverage. The access the author had to the Disney archives shows. The photos are great too. The only drawback, in my opinion, is the price guide. The book really didn't need to have one. I find the prices to be ludicrously high, and will only hurt the hobby once record sellers start using these inflated prices to mark items.
